informix 存储过程 编译
时间: 2023-09-18 10:04:22 浏览: 45
Informix存储过程是在数据库中存储的一段预编译的SQL代码,具有独立的名字和参数。
编译是指将存储过程的源代码转换成执行计划,以便在需要执行该存储过程时能够更高效地运行。
Informix数据库提供了一个名为存储过程(SP)编辑器的工具来编译存储过程。
在编译过程中,存储过程的源代码会被解析、语法检查和优化。如果源代码中存在语法错误,编译过程会报错并指出具体的错误信息,以供开发人员进行修正。在通过了语法检查后,存储过程的代码将会被优化处理,以提高执行效率。
通过编译,数据库会为存储过程创建执行计划。执行计划包含了查询优化器对存储过程进行的优化决策,以及如何通过索引和缓存等技术来提高执行速度。执行计划的生成是根据存储过程的访问路径、连接关系和查询条件等来进行的。
在编译过程中,还可以指定优化选项来进一步控制存储过程的执行计划,以便满足特定的性能需求。例如,可以通过设置优化选项来选择不同的索引策略、调整查询连接顺序,甚至使用并行执行等方式来提高存储过程的执行效率。
总之,编译是将Informix存储过程源代码转换为执行计划的过程,通过优化和生成合适的执行计划,可以提高存储过程的执行效率和性能。
相关问题
informix下载
您可以前往IBM官方网站,该网站提供了Informix数据库的下载。您可以访问以下***/downloads/im/informix/index.html
在该网页上,您可以找到适用于各种操作系统的Informix数据库的安装包。请根据您的操作系统选择合适的安装包进行下载。
另外,为了成功安装Informix数据库,您还需要按照以下步骤创建安装目录和用户:
1. 创建安装目录:
执行命令:mkdir /opt/informix
执行命令:chown informix:informix /opt/informix
2. 创建informix用户:
执行命令:groupadd -g 1000 informix
执行命令:useradd -g informix -d /opt/informix -m -s /bin/bash informix
执行命令:passwd informix
完成以上步骤后,您就可以在下载页面获取到的安装包中找到适合您操作系统的版本进行安装了。希望对您有所帮助!
informix部署
关于Informix的部署,您可以按照以下步骤进行操作:
1. 下载和安装Informix软件:您可以从IBM官方网站下载Informix软件,确保选择适合您操作系统的版本。安装过程中,请确保遵循所有安装步骤和要求。
2. 配置Informix服务器:安装完成后,您需要配置Informix服务器。配置包括设置数据库实例、网络通信和安全性设置等。您可以使用提供的工具(如"oninit"命令)来完成这些配置。
3. 创建和管理数据库:配置完成后,您可以使用Informix提供的工具(如dbaccess或dbaccess demo)创建和管理数据库。通过这些工具,您可以执行SQL命令、创建表、插入数据等。
4. 连接和访问数据库:完成数据库的创建和管理后,您可以使用Informix提供的客户端工具(如dbaccess或ODBC驱动程序)连接并访问数据库。这些工具允许您执行查询、更新数据等操作。
5. 监控和维护数据库:在部署完成后,您需要定期监控和维护Informix数据库,以确保其性能和安全。您可以使用Informix提供的工具(如onstat或oncheck)来监控数据库的状态,并执行必要的维护操作。
请注意,以上只是一个基本的部署流程示例,具体的步骤可能会因您的需求和环境而有所不同。建议您参考Informix官方文档和指南,以获取更详细和准确的部署指导。